20' HC Open Top Container: A Versatile Shipping Solution

A popular 20' high cube (HC) open top container offers unmatched flexibility in freight transport. These containers are constructed to provide a spacious, unobstructed loading space for handling an array of merchandise. From heavy machinery to general freight, the open top design facilitates easy loading and unloading employing various tools.

This setup is particularly beneficial for industries that transport items of unusual shape or size, offering a cost-effective solution for their shipping needs.

The open top design also enhances safety during transport as it allows for easy inspection of the load. Additionally, these containers are often furnished with covers to safeguard the cargo from weather, ensuring its quality throughout the journey.

Transporting Outsized Shipments with a 20' Flat Rack Container

When shipping large and bulky cargo, a standard container simply. This is where the 20' Flat Rack Container steps up as a robust alternative designed to accommodate these unique shipments.

Built with heavy-duty steel structure, these containers offer an flat platform, enabling you to safely load a wide selection of items. Whether it's machinery for construction projects or large structures, the 20' Flat Rack Container provides the stability necessary to guarantee safe transit.

One of the key advantages of a 20' Flat Rack Container is its versatility. They can be adapted with various add-ons like side rails and lashing points, moreover improving the safety of your cargo during transit.

Selecting the Right Container: A Guide to 10', 20', and HC Options

When picking a container for your shipment, it's crucial to analyze factors like capacity and intended use. Standard container sizes typically include 10', 20', and HC (High Cube). Each alternative presents unique benefits.

A 10' container is ideal for compact cargos. It's more inexpensive and simpler to handle. A 20' container is the most popular size, offering a good combination of capacity and affordability. It can contain a larger range of goods.

The HC container, also known as a High Cube, is taller than a standard 20' container. This increased volume allows for increased load. However, it may require additional care due to its size.
